The DC040B series brush commutated DC motor is a unit with a diameter of 40 mm, available in 6 lengths, and a continuous output torque range of 0.017 to 0.081 Nm.

characteristic:
  • The speed may reach up to 8000 RPM
  • DC bus voltage up to 48 Vdc
  • Eight standard windings, special windings available
  • 2-pole stator with ceramic magnet
  • Reduce the torque of the 7-slot inclined armature tooth slot
  • Sintered Bronze Bearings - Ball Bearings Available
  • Copper graphite brush - can provide RFI suppression

    E30C&E30D Encoder
    The E30C and E30D optical incremental encoders are designed specifically for batch OEM precision motion control applications and are recommended encoders for DC040B. The E30 has a compact structure with dimensions of only 30 mm x 8 mm, providing various output, resolution, and connectivity solutions.

    characteristic:
    • The resolution ranges from 200 to 2048
    • TTL orthogonal output
    • Frequency response up to 220 kHz
    • Low power consumption, maximum 5V @ 20mA
    • Lock connector

    G30A gear
    G30A is a 30mm planetary gearbox suitable for DC brushed and brushless servo motor applications. The G30A has the highest efficiency, smallest clearance, and smaller mechanical dimensions, as well as circular and square installation end cap configurations to choose from.

    characteristic:
    • Sintered metal gears with high torque capacity
    • Sintered metal output bearing

    G51A gear
    G51A is an economical 51mm offset spur gearbox suitable for applications with lower torque. Brushed motors have a wide range of sintered steel gear combinations to choose from to meet different deceleration requirements. G51A also has high torque or wide face gears suitable for higher output loads.

    characteristic:
    • The maximum load torque of the standard model can reach 1.24 Nm
    • The load of the high torque configuration can reach 2.12 Nm, while the load of the wide face configuration can reach 3.53 Nm
    • Standard bronze bearings
    Optional:
    • Special lubrication for extreme conditions
    • Ball bearings for high radial loads
    • Polyoxymethylene resin gears for noise reduction

    B30A brake
    B30A power-off, fail safe hold brake design is used to keep the load stationary when the motor and brake are powered off. The holding torque of this compact 30mm brake is 0.113 Nm (1 pound inch). B30A is usually installed at the rear of the motor.

    characteristic:
    • Maintain a torque of 0.113 Nm
    • Factory set air gap
    • Thin mounting plate
    • Rigid molded friction disc
